As part of the Dallas Holocaust Museum’s Upstander Speaker Series, Chief Rabbi of Poland Michael Schudrich will give a talk at 6:30 p.m. Thursday at the Jewish Community Center. Schudrich is known as the “24/7 Rabbi” for his tireless efforts to rebuild Jewish life in Poland after it was almost completely obliterated during the Holocaust.  Since the fall of Communism in 1989, a growing number of Poles have learned of their Jewish roots. Rabbi Schudrich is the person they often turn to for help.
